The improved features of the Ring Video Doorbell 2020 allow you to see, hear, and talk to any individual who comes to your doorstep, even when you’re not at home. Its enhanced motion detection system triggers the doorbell, prompting it to start recording and notifying you when it detects movement within its range. With this enhancement, you’ll never have to miss a visitor or package again.
Moreover, this video doorbell’s broad compatibility lets you check your system and interact with visitors on any device, be it on your computer, tablet, or smartphone. You can connect multiple iOS, Android, Mac, or Windows devices to plug in everyone in your family if they want to be. This device also runs entirely on battery power, so you don’t have to worry about hardwiring it in your home.

Keeping your home secure doesn’t have to mean blowing your budget. With the ieGeek Wireless Video Doorbell, you can ensure that you, your family, and your abode are well-protected at a budget-friendly price. This video doorbell’s wide monitoring range allows you to keep track of any movement over 20 feet away. It delivers a wide viewing angle to reduce your blind spots, so you can see more of the view outside your door and oversee your surroundings better.
Its motion detection system is intelligent enough to alert you of any suspicious human activity, so you can immediately act when you have to. You can even customize the motion sensitivity of this video doorbell to suit your needs and minimize the instances of mistaking your neighbor’s dog for an intruder.

With its sophisticated surveillance system, the eufy Security Video Doorbell ensures that you have a comprehensible view and recording of the things happening on the other side of your door. It provides a 2K resolution image quality to easily see and recognize anyone who approaches your door, even in low-light or backlit scenarios. This video doorbell also uses a 4:3 aspect ratio, allowing you to have a more expansive view of your doorstep from top to bottom.
Additionally, you can easily interact with anyone who rings your doorbell through this device’s two-way audio, letting your mailman know where to safely leave your package or tell your surprise visitor when you’ll be coming home. This video doorbell is also compatible with Amazon Alexa and Google Voice Assistant, making controls more manageable and hands-free.

One of the most significant issues with video doorbells is that they can appear distorted, fish-eye-looking videos. Arlo’s Video Doorbell camera doesn’t suffer the same fate, thanks to its HD camera with a 180-degree viewing angle and a 1:1 aspect ratio that allows you to fully view the person and scene in front of the doorbell’s camera. With this enhanced perspective, you’ll get to see the packages you’ve been waiting for and reduce blind spots in your area of concern.
Thanks to its motion-triggered sensors, this video doorbell also prevents you from missing any relevant events within its line of sight. Its security camera also records the first few seconds before it detects movement. The doorbell’s night vision capabilities provide added protection, so you can sleep soundly knowing that the device will keep watch of your home front throughout the night.

The best way to ensure that your video doorbell will not get stolen is by mounting it securely to your door frame or the wall on your porch. You can also install an anti-theft grid box for added security.
Video doorbells do not continuously record unless stated by the manufacturer, and these devices usually start recording when their motion sensors are triggered by movement.
